Step-by-Step Guide: Earning a License from Scratch
If you do not hold a valid foreign license recognized by Poland, you must go through the standard training and testing process.
Action 1: Obtain a PKK Number (Profil Kandydata Polskie Prawo Jazdy Na Sprzedaż Kierowcę)
Before starting driving lessons, candidates must acquire a Candidate Driver Profile. To do this, one needs:
- A valid house card, visa, or proof of legal stay in Poland (together with PESEL number).
- A medical certificate from an authorized occupational medication doctor confirming physical fitness to drive.
- A current passport-sized photo.
- A completed application kind sent to the local district office (Urząd Dzielnicy or Starostwo Powiatowe).
Action 2: Complete the Training
Once the PKK number is provided, prospects must enroll in a state-approved driving school (Ośrodek Szkolenia Kierowców - OSK).
- Theoretical training: Usually consists of around 30 hours of class or online lectures covering traffic rules and road indications.
- Practical training: Typically requires a minimum of 30 hours behind the wheel with an instructor.

Documents Required for the Official Process
To guarantee a smooth application procedure at your local federal government workplace, make sure to collect the following documentation:
- Application Form: Available at the regional Urząd or downloadable online.
- ID Document: Passport or home card (Karta Pobytu).
- Proof of Legal Residence: Registration of short-lived or irreversible home (Zameldowanie) or proof of studying/working in Poland for a minimum of 185 days.
- Medical Report: Issued by a licensed physician.
- Photograph: One current, clear image (35x45 mm).
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. Can I drive in Poland with my foreign driver's license?
Yes, if you are going to as a tourist, your home country's license-- alongside an International Driving Permit (IDP) if your license is not in English or Polish-- is generally valid for up to 6 months. If you establish residency, more stringent timelines apply.
2. Can I take the driving examinations in English?
Yes. Major WORD centers in cities like Warsaw, Kraków, Wrocław, and Poznań use theoretical tests in English. For the practical exam, you might bring a sworn translator Polskie Prawo Jazdy Online at your own expenditure, though some inspectors speak conversational English.
3. What happens if I get caught utilizing a phony "purchased" driver's license?
Utilizing a created document is a crime under Article 270 of the Polish Penal Code. It can lead to heavy fines, limitation of liberty, or imprisonment for as much as 5 years, alongside a long-term restriction from obtaining a legal license.
